Break-even EBIT (with and without taxes). Alpha Company is looking at two different capital structures, one an all-equity firm and the other a levered firm with $1.52 million of debt financing at 13% interest. The all-equity firm will have a value of $3.8 million and 380,000 shares outstanding. The levered firm will have 228,000 shares outstanding, a. Find the break-even EBIT for Alpha Company using EPS if there are no corporate taxes. b. Find the break-even EBIT for Alpha Company using EPS if the corporate tax rate is 25%. c. What do you notice about these two break-even EBITs for Alpha Company
